Output 669933ee00a06bc4e4461c5409c278b05d06d49a817a1a90ff488f10755edd48:8

value
26157855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e061b1a97259972c27e3a794c478e3f02225fc18 OP_EQUAL
address
MUMadJDtgaya5po2SoS2bVwEK5cPM4pV9w
transaction
669933ee00a06bc4e4461c5409c278b05d06d49a817a1a90ff488f10755edd48
spent
true